Design and Comfort
This sleeveless vest boasts a Y2K-era retro design, appealing to those who appreciate vintage outdoor aesthetics. Made from polar fleece, it provides lightweight warmth, ideal for early morning or late evening fishing trips when temperatures drop. The full-zip closure allows for easy layering over a hoodie or under a waterproof shell, making it versatile for changing weather conditions.

For anglers, the sleeveless design is a plus—it ensures unrestricted arm movement for casting and reeling. The large size (Men’s L) offers a relaxed fit, accommodating thicker layers underneath without feeling constricted.

Durability and Functionality
Fishing demands durable gear, and the Black Diamond Vest holds up well. The polar fleece material is resistant to pilling and abrasion, meaning it won’t wear out quickly even with frequent use. Unlike bulkier jackets, this vest is breathable, preventing overheating during active fishing sessions.

One downside is the lack of pockets. Many fishing vests come with multiple storage options for tackle, tools, or small accessories, but this model is minimalist. If you rely on vest pockets for quick access to gear, you might need to pair it with a fishing bag or belt.
